    Central Transport Operations Lead

    Role Outline

    • The Central Transport Operations Lead is responsible for the strategic planning, coordination, control and continuous improvement of transport operations across multiple sites, regions or customers. The role ensures the safe, cost-effective, compliant and efficient movement of goods while achieving service-level targets.

    About the role key duties and responsibilities

    • Oversee daily transport operations across the assigned network.
    • Monitor fleet utilization and optimize vehicle routing, load planning and vehicle allocation.
    • Optimize vehicle allocation to maximize capacity utilization.
    • Ensure timely dispatch and delivery of customer orders.
    • Use transportation management systems and tracking tools to monitor shipments and vehicles in real time.
    • Ensure on-time collection and delivery of shipments.
    • Resolve operational issues and service disruptions promptly.
    • Monitor fleet performance, availability and utilization.
    • Drive initiatives to improve vehicle productivity and reduce downtime.
    • Monitor fuel consumption and driver productivity.
    • Promote a positive safety culture and employee engagement.
    • Ensure service levels meet or exceed contractual customer expectations.
    • Ensure adherence to transport regulations, axle-load requirements and road safety standards.
    • Ensure fleet compliance with regulatory and company standards.
    • Identify cost-saving opportunities without compromising service delivery.
    • Manage transport-related supplier and contractor performance.
    • Ensure compliance with transport legislation, road safety regulations and company policies.
    • Ensure driver compliance with licensing, permits and training requirements.
    • Ensure loads leave within the agreed dispatch window and control delivery documents, keys, GPS devices, fuel cards and mobile phones.
    • Coordinate resolution of delivery issues with customer service and relevant stakeholders.
    • Support team performance, workload balancing and achievement of individual development objectives.

    About you

    • Degree/Diploma in Logistics and supply chain.
    • Experience in fleet utilization, routing, load planning, vehicle allocation, dispatch, delivery control, transport exceptions, TMS/tracking tools, fuel monitoring, driver productivity and supplier performance.
    • 10 years in logistics; transport or supply chain industry exposure required.
    • Working knowledge of structured problem solving, performance reporting and continuous improvement methods.
    • Supply chain, transport or logistics industry experience, with practical exposure to customer service and distribution operations.
    • National business knowledge and the ability to work effectively across diverse cultural and stakeholder environments.

    Transport Administrator (Subcontractor)

    Role Outline

    • The Transport Administrator provides administrative and operational support to transport operations, ensuring efficient coordination of vehicles, drivers, documentation, compliance and reporting. The role supports smooth day-to-day transport activities, service delivery and cost-control objectives.

    About the role key duties and responsibilities

    • Coordinate daily transport activities.
    • Ensure transport records are complete, accurate and properly filed.
    • Maintain documentation for audit and compliance purposes.
    • Track vehicle licensing, insurance and permit renewals.
    • Assist in managing driver’s timesheets and payroll inputs.
    • Update fleet databases and transport management systems.
    • Ensure compliance with transport regulations and company policies.
    • Monitor fleet performance, availability and utilization.
    • Identify discrepancies and escalate them for resolution.
    • Support investigations into accidents and transport incidents.
    • Promote a positive safety culture and employee engagement.
    • Track traffic violations, fines and corrective actions.
    • Generate daily, weekly and monthly transport reports.
    • Ensure fleet compliance with regulatory and company standards.
    • Monitor axle-load and weighbridge compliance requirements.
    • Track traffic violations, fines and corrective actions.
    • Ensure compliance with transport legislation, road safety regulations and company policies.
    • Ensure driver compliance with licensing, permits and training requirements.
    • Support dispatch control and manage delivery documents, vehicle keys, GPS devices, fuel cards and mobile phones.
    • Coordinate communication on delivery issues with customer service and relevant stakeholders.
    • Support team performance, workload balance and achievement of personal development objectives.

    About you

    • Diploma or deg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management or a related field; relevant professional qualification.
    • 2-5 years in logistics, transport administration or a related operational environment.
    • Proven transport administration or dispatch experience, preferably within the logistics industry.
    • Experience coordinating daily transport activities, maintaining transport and driver records, tracking compliance renewals, updating fleet databases or TMS, preparing reports, supporting payroll inputs and escalating discrepancies.
    • Experience supporting Kenya-based transport operations and applicable local road transport requirements.
    • Fluent written and spoken communication.
